Interventions
DRUG

Cyclophosphamide 50mg

One tablet per day. Cyclophosphamide will continue to be administered as long as patient experiences clinical benefit in the opinion of the investigator or symptomatic deterioration attributed to disease progression as determined by the investigator after an integrated assessment of radiographic data and clinical status or withdrawal of consent.

DRUG

Pembrolizumab 100 MG in 4 ML Injection

IV infusion every 3 weeks. Pembrolizumab will continue to be administered as long as patient experiences clinical benefit in the opinion of the investigator or symptomatic deterioration attributed to disease progression as determined by the investigator after an integrated assessment of radiographic data and clinical status or withdrawal of consent.
